Output 57f868cfbec7100c5956823f0b3a7c608e18a8478d27fefdb94a337658e0330d:1

value
519520
script pubkey
OP_0 OP_PUSHBYTES_20 8c5eb61c4997f99b12994c9fdc03ffbb5fd4f81d
address
ltc1q330tv8zfjlueky5efj0acqllhd0af7qavxuldx
transaction
57f868cfbec7100c5956823f0b3a7c608e18a8478d27fefdb94a337658e0330d
spent
true